Ghost Immobiliser Review A ghost immobiliser stops car thieves from stealing your vehicle. It connects to the CAN of your vehicle and prevents engine start until a pin code entered by the user is entered. It's completely undetectable and impossible to bypass This makes it one of the most effective options to increase your vehicle's security. It's also approved by Thatcham and can lower your insurance rates. Easy to install Ghost immobilisers are an excellent option if you are looking to secure your car in a quick and easy way. These devices work to combat key hacking, cloning and keyless entry which makes it harder for thieves to take your vehicle. The device blocks your car from starting unless you enter a PIN code or code sequence using a dashboard button. This makes it virtually impossible for criminals to copy your key fob or steal your car. The device can be set up in a hidden location and operates silently. Before installing the immobiliser, it is important to familiarise yourself with your vehicle's wiring diagram. This will allow you to identify the right wires and ensure that you connect them correctly. Additionally, it is important to work in a well-lit space to ensure that you can see the wires clearly. It is also a good idea to use cable tie to secure and bundle any loose wires. This will ensure that they are not accidentally ripped off or moved during operation of the car. After installing the ghost-immobiliser you are able to set up a service settings for your vehicle so that it is able to be transferred for servicing or valet parking. This feature can be activated by pressing buttons on the steering wheel and door panel as well as the central console in a specific sequence. This sequence is fully customizable and can be programmed to up to 20 presses. It is recommended to practice the disarm sequence before you are required to use it, since the procedure could differ slightly for every vehicle model. The system works by connecting to the CAN bus, the internal communication system within your vehicle that connects all its electronic components. It then intercepts signals that normally go to the key fob of your vehicle and stops it from operating without a specific PIN number is entered. This is a code that is unique that can only be set by the owner, so it's extremely difficult for thieves to guess or brute force.
